How they compare

Ireland currently reports 18,034 1000 USD against 16,411 1000 USD in Malawi, a difference of 1,623 1000 USD.

That makes Ireland's figure about 1.1 times Malawi's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 19 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Malawi ahead.

Ireland ranks 13th and Malawi ranks 14th of 128 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Ireland averaged higher in 1 and Malawi in 2.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
